GlideCurrency-Symbol: Bereichsbezogen, Global
Die GlideCurrency-Symbol Die API stellt Methoden zum Abrufen von Währungssymbolen bereit.
Symbolinformationen sind auch in der Tabelle „Währung“ [fx_currency] verfügbar, diese API verfügt jedoch über ein integriertes Caching, das die an fx_currency ausgegebenen Abfragen minimiert.
Mit dieser API können Sie an beliebiger Stelle mit Währungssymbolen arbeiten ServiceNow AI Platform, Nicht nur in Währung Und FX-Währung Felder.
Diese API erfordert das Plugin „FX Currency“ (com.Glide.currcy2), das standardmäßig verfügbar ist. Diese API wird in bereitgestellt sn_currency Namespace.
GlideCurrency cySymbol – getCurrency Symbol(Zeichenfolge LetterCode)
Gibt das entsprechende Symbol für einen bestimmten alphabetischen Währungscode zurück.
| Name | Typ | Beschreibung |
|---|---|---|
| LetterCode | Zeichenfolge | Alphabetischer ISO 4217-Währungscode. |
| Typ | Beschreibung |
|---|---|
| Zeichenfolge | Währungssymbol für den angegebenen Code. |
Dieses Beispiel gibt das Währungssymbol für US-Dollar (USD) zurück.
gs.info(sn_currency.GlideCurrencySymbol.getCurrencySymbol("USD"));
Ausgabe:
$
GlideCurrency-Symbol – getSortedActiveCurrency Symbols()
Gibt alle Währungssymbole zurück, die derzeit in der Instanz aktiv sind.
| Name | Typ | Beschreibung |
|---|---|---|
| Keine |
| Typ | Beschreibung |
|---|---|
| Array | Array von Währungssymbolobjekten, die derzeit in der Instanz aktiv sind. Symbole werden in sortierter Reihenfolge nach ihrem Unicode-Code zurückgegeben, der auch beim Sortieren nach Symbol in der Tabelle „Währung“ [fx_currency] verwendet wird. |
| <Array>.Code | Währungscode. Datentyp: Zeichenfolge |
| <Array>.Symbol | Währungssymbol. Datentyp: Zeichenfolge |
In diesem Beispiel werden alle Währungscodes und Symbole aufgelistet, die derzeit in der Instanz aktiv sind.
var symbols = sn_currency.GlideCurrencySymbol.getSortedActiveCurrencySymbols();
for (idx in symbols) {
gs.info(symbols[idx]["code"] + ": " + symbols[idx]["symbol"]);
};
Ausgabe:
USD: $
CHF: CHF
GBP: £
JPY: ¥
EUR: €